symbolist
(noun) a member of an artistic movement that expressed ideas indirectly via symbols
symbolist, symbolizer, symboliser
(noun) someone skilled in the interpretation or representation of symbols

symbolist (not comparable)
(arts, literature) Of or pertaining to the Symbolist movement in late 19th-century and early 20th-century European arts and literature
symbolist (plural symbolists)
One who employs symbols.
